Excel vba select range from different sheet
WebApr 9, 2024 · This method is useful when we want to copy and paste across worksheet. Last row can be redefined as: Range ("A65536").End (xlUp) (2).Select --> Archivelrow = Worksheets ("ARCHIVE").Cells (Rows.Count, 2).End (xlUp).Row, where lrow will be the variable which we can use to refer to the last row. 3A - We can loop through each cell in … http://www.vbaexpress.com/forum/showthread.php?30325-VBA-Target-value
Excel vba select range from different sheet
Did you know?
WebDec 24, 2016 · How can I select data range for a chart from different sheet using VBA? Suppose that data sheet name is data_sheet, chart sheet name is chart_sheet, and my data range is A1:A20. How can I do this in excel? I checked THIS but didn't work for different sheets. Otherwise, I checked THIS but returned this error: Subscript out of range: WebAug 6, 2024 · 2 Answers. Sorted by: 0. Just fully reference cells: data_table = Worksheets (DATASHEET).Range ( _ Worksheets (DATASHEET).Cells (1, col), _ Worksheets (DATASHEET).Cells (lastrow, col + 5) ).Value. Also, use Long instead of Integer - integers are stored as longs anyway in VBA, so they take as much space and just give you more …
WebMar 29, 2024 · The following code example copies the formulas in cells A1:D4 on Sheet1 into cells E5:H8 on Sheet2. VB. Worksheets ("Sheet1").Range ("A1:D4").Copy _ destination:=Worksheets ("Sheet2").Range ("E5") The following code example inspects the value in column D for each row on Sheet1. If the value in column D equals A, the entire … WebJul 19, 2013 · Here's an excerpt from Excel 2003 help: "If you use the Select method to select cells, be aware that Select works only on the active worksheet. If you run your …
WebMay 22, 2015 · Excel does not know what you're talking about. Declare it and it will work. See this example. Sub test() Dim ws As Worksheet Dim rng1 As Range, rng2 As Range Set ws = … WebApr 2, 2014 · Sorted by: 34. This isn't using the built in that you showed above, but does allow you to select a range of cells following an income prompt: Sub RangeSelectionPrompt () Dim rng As Range Set rng = …
WebJan 14, 2024 · And if you want to automate your work in Excel using VBA, you need to know how to work with cells and ranges using VBA. There are a lot of different things you can …
WebFeb 19, 2024 · First of all, press Alt + F11 to open the VBA Macro. Click on the Insert. Choose the Module. Step 2: Paste the following VBA. Sub Select_a_Cell () Worksheets … da dove ha origine il niloWebSelecting a Variably Sized Range. There are different ways you can select a range of cells. The method you choose would depend on how the data is structured. In this section, I will cover some useful techniques that … da dove hanno origine le violazioniWebStep 1: Write the subcategory of VBA Selection Range as shown below. Code: Sub Selection_Range3 () End Sub Step 2: By this process, we can select the range of any specific sheet which we want. We don’t need to make that sheet as current. Use Worksheet function to activate the sheet which wants by putting the name or sequence … da dove ha origine il nome piemonteWebSep 24, 2015 · There is an important distinction between Worksheet objects and Sheet objects: Worksheet can contain only data (in cells) Sheet can contain data, and other objects like Charts, combo boxes, list boxes, etc. To declare a Worksheet variable use Worksheet type. To declare a Sheet variable use its CodeName, that appears before … da dove derivano i giorni della settimanaWebYou need to fully define the sheet location of Cells like you did for Range. Instead of: Set rr = Worksheets ("EOD").Range (Cells (2, 3), Cells (100, 3)) Try: Dim wks1 As Worksheet Set wks1 = Worksheets ("EOD") Set rr = wks1.Range (wks1.Cells (2, 3), wks1.Cells (100, 3)) Share Follow answered Nov 19, 2014 at 20:33 Automate This 30.5k 11 62 82 da dove parte il giro d\\u0027italiaWebMar 26, 2024 · Converting a range to a table as described in this answer: Sub CreateTable () ActiveSheet.ListObjects.Add (xlSrcRange, Range ("$B$1:$D$16"), , xlYes).Name = _ "Table1" 'No go in 2003 ActiveSheet.ListObjects ("Table1").TableStyle = "TableStyleLight2" End Sub Share Improve this answer da dove ha avuto origine la musica reggaeWebJun 2, 2016 · Dim i As Integer, j As Integer, k As Integer k = 1 'row counter for destination sheet 'loop sheets 3-9 For i = 3 To 9 'loop rows 2-57 For j = 2 To 57 'if C is not empty If WrkBookSrs.Sheets(i).Cells(j, 3).Value <> "" Then 'copy A:C on this row to the destination sheet column G row k WrkBookSrs.Sheets(i).Range("A" & j & ":C" & j).Copy ... da dove nasce il nome europa